Astrologer-Turned-Musician Frankie Fonseca Releases Fifth Album “Retrograde”

An Alternative Rock Journey Inspired by Identity, Legacy, and the Stars

Gloucester Township, New Jersey Dec 15, 2024 (Issuewire.com)  - Frankie Fonseca, a trailblazing transmasculine musician, poet, and activist, has announced the release of his highly anticipated fifth album, Retrograde. A fusion of alternative rock, punk, grunge, and indie influences, the album explores themes of healing, heartbreak, and pushing against the barriers of invisibility within marginalized communities. Released incrementally between now and February, Retrograde promises to push boundaries while offering deeply personal and universal stories.

With two singles from the album already out—“Retrograde”, the title track, and “Venus Opposite Mars”—Fonseca’s music reflects his unique path as a generational curse breaker and the first in his lineage to pursue an artistic life over a practical one. Drawing from his multicultural heritage as the great-grandson of former Colombian President Deogracias Fonseca on one side and Nova Scotia Mi’kmaq ancestry on the other, Frankie’s work channels a legacy of resilience, storytelling, and defiance.

“I wrote this album as a map through the chaos of transformation,” said Fonseca. “The astrological concept of retrogrades mirrors so much of what it means to undo inherited patterns and carve out your own identity, especially as a trans person. This music is my way of taking something challenging and turning it into art that speaks to healing and breaking free from invisibility.”

Frankie’s artistry doesn’t stop at music. Each of his album covers is hand-painted by Frankie without the use of paint brushes, showcasing his raw, hands-on approach to creativity. The covers serve as visual extensions of the music’s themes, translating emotion and story into textured, striking images.

Known for his raw, emotive lyrics and electric soundscapes, Fonseca’s work is steeped in celestial metaphors, drawing on his expertise as an astrologer. The album’s second single, “Venus Opposite Mars”, delves into the tension between love and conflict, while the title track “Retrograde” offers a powerful reflection on revisiting the past to move forward.
